2.2.2 Network Connection
There are two ways to use the 10/100Base-T Ethernet connec- tor located on the ADAM-4570/ADAM-4571/EDG-4504 :
1.For Local Area Network (LAN) applications using the ADAM-4570/ADAM-4571/EDG-4504, you will simply plug one end of your Ethernetcable into the 10/100Base-T con- nector, and the other end into the hub connected to your net- work.
2.When installing and configuring, you will find it convenient
to hook the ADAM-4570/ADAM-4571/EDG-4504 directly to your computer’s Ethernet card. To do this you will need to use a “crossed-cable”, such as the one supplied with your server.
Cabling requirements for the Ethernet side
Use an RJ-45 connector to connect the Ethernet port of the ADAM-4570/ADAM-4571/EDG-4504 to the network hub. The cable for connection should be Category 3 (for 10Mbps data rate) or Category 5 (for 100 Mbps data rate) UTP/STP cable, which is compliant with EIA/TIA 586 specifications. Maximum length between the hub and any ADAM-4570/ ADAM-4571/EDG-4504 is up to 100 meters (ca. 300 ft).
